Earlier this year, we reported the news that Sonic the Hedgehog was headed to the big-screen, with an adventure that's set to shoot sometime this summer, for release over the course of next year. Today at CinemaCon, we got our very first look at the title logo of the film (thanks to ComicBook staff) -- and it's bound to be very familiar with fans of the speedy hero.

The title, which you can see below, appears to be similar to the classic game title, with gold lettering in the "Sonic" name and blue letters for "The Hedgehog." But, on top of that, we also get a faint image of what Sonic will likely look in the film -- and he resembles his video game counterpart from more recent releases like Sonic Forces.

As noted in our previous story, "Sonic will be a mix of live-action and CGI and will be directed by Jeff Fowler, who is making his directorial debut. Neil H. Moritz is also serving as producer, while Dmitri Johnson and Dan Jevons will act as co-producers. Toby Ascher is also serving as an executive producer."

Sonic the Hedgehog will speed his way to theaters on November 15, 2019.
